Job description

Other Available Locations: Ohio; Kentucky

Basic Job Functions:

Safety is the most important part of all jobs within Nucor; therefore, candidates must be able to demonstrate the ability to initiate, lead, and uphold safety policies, practices, procedures, and housekeeping standards at all times.

  • Properly follow company and OSHA safety procedures.
  • Operate mobile heavy equipment of various sizes and types (front end loader, skid steer, grapple and magnet material handlers).
  • Communicates over radio with team members for traffic coordination, production, and safety procedures.
  • Perform daily inspections on equipment and report any defects or needed repairs to supervisor.
  • Clean equipment as needed.
  • Greet customers coming into the yard and direct them to the proper location to unload materials from their vehicles.
  • Inspect material brought in by our customers for existence of non-acceptable items and ensure that those prohibited materials are not left on Company property. Examples are propane tanks, batteries, etc.
  • Interact with customers and team members to facilitate a safe and productive yard environment.
Minimum Qualifications:
  • 2-3 years’ experience using a front-end loader, skid steer or scrap handler in an industrial/outdoor work environment.
  • Knowledge of heavy-equipment operating principles.
  • Ability to operate equipment under varying working conditions.
  • Ability to effectively communicate in English.
  • Ability to understand and carry out written and oral instructions.
  • Ability to meet attendance schedule with dependability and consistency.
  • Working knowledge of hazards and safety precautions common to heavy equipment operations.
  • Ability to communicate effectively with others and coordinate work activities as a team.
